When it comes to stretch film manufacturing, two dominant processes stand out: cast and blown film production. Each method has unique characteristics that affect the quality, performance, and application of the final product. Cast film is known for its clarity, uniform thickness, and excellent hold performance, making it ideal for applications requiring high visibility and tear resistance. On the other hand, blown film offers superior stretchability and puncture resistance, making it a strong choice for heavy-duty packaging needs. In the competitive landscape of the packaging industry, choosing between cast and blown film often depends on the specific needs of the application. For global buyers, understanding the strengths of each method can lead to more informed purchasing decisions. Cast films are often preferred in sectors like retail and food packaging, where aesthetics and performance are crucial, while blown films are frequently utilized in industrial settings where strength and durability are paramount. | Dimension | Cast Film | Blown Film |
|---|---|---|
| Thickness (µm) | 10-50 | 15-100 |
| Clarity | High | Moderate |
| Tensile Strength (MPa) | 30-50 | 20-40 |
| Elasticity (%) | 200 | 300 |
| Processing Speed | High | Moderate |
| Cost Efficiency | Low | High |
